My character just had a daughter and I created an army to have my character's husband join my party but got a notification that she was with child before my character's husband arrived.
 
Yeah, the whole "Spending time with your spouse" aspect seems to be broken. I had 2 children with my character's wife and was not with her in either circumstance. In both cases, I was traveling with the Western Empire army in the Battanian lands and got the indication of my wife being pregnant while she was holding in Husn Fulq.
 
From my observations you only have to visit your spouse in a settlement once. If you don't visit them after birth they don't get pregnant. Or skip time until 36 the rate seems to slow down.

Unfortunately, my character's wife is still having babies at 40+ and I've seen reports on these forums that people are still having children in their 50's.
 
I was actually informed last night that it's coded so women can get pregnant between 18 and 45. So at 46 she can come out of the castle.
